Nestled in the picturesque Surrey countryside, Box Hill & Westhumble train station is a charming gateway for both local and visiting travelers. Whether you're planning a cultural visit to London or a rural escape to the beautiful Surrey hills, this station offers a unique blend of tranquil surroundings and travel convenience.
While Box Hill & Westhumble might not boast large facilities, it provides essential amenities for a smooth travel experience. The station operates without a ticket office but has convenient 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ets. These machines are capable of processing tickets with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ring accessible options are in place. Induction loops are available, enhancing accessibility for those with hearing impairments.
Though the station lacks toilets and waiting facilities, it makes up for it with a picturesque waiting atmosphere and ample seating areas. Security is a priority with CCTV surveillance in place. For cyclists, secure bicycle racks are available, though it's advised to use them at your own risk. Free parking is available around the clock, and though there are no refreshment facilities, you'll find a cycle repair shop nearby to attend to biking needs.
The station supports accessible travel with step-free access to platform 2, with assistance available upon request. However, access to platform 1 requires the use of a footbridge. If assistance is needed, help points are strategically placed, making it convenient for travelers to reach out. Accessible parking and a designated mobility set-down area are available in the car park.
Care is taken to ensure that all travelers can access services smoothly, with assistive services available through Southern's dedicated teams. Those requiring additional travel support are encouraged to pre-book assistance to have their needs fully accommodated during their journey.

Nestled in the north of Glasgow, Possilpark & Parkhouse train station serves as an important hub for both locals and visitors. While its amenities might be more limited compared to grander stations, it offers the essential services needed for smooth journeys across Scotland. Whether you're commuting to Glasgow's bustling city center or planning a day trip to the scenic outskirts, this station is your convenient launch pad. Let's delve into the facilities available at Possilpark & Parkhouse and the exciting travel opportunities from this station.
Possilpark & Parkhouse train station might not be brimming with facilities, but it ensures a safe and secure environment with CCTV in place. There is no ticket office, so passengers need to purchase and collect their tickets online or at another station equipped with ticket machines. Those traveling with smartcards will find smartcard validators at the station for easy check-ins. While the station does not offer accessible ticket machines or tactile ramps, there is some step-free access available. It’s important to be cautious during boarding due to the possible gap between the train and the platform.
For those needing help or information, the station houses customer help points and a help point staff where passengers can address their queries. However, there are no public Wi-Fi services or refreshment facilities available, so plan ahead to keep connected and refreshed during your journey.
Possilpark & Parkhouse station is well-connected to various forms of transport, making onward journeys hassle-free. There's a rail replacement bus service that picks up and drops off passengers on the main road outside the station. Discover all local bus services in detail by visiting Traveline Scotland or contacting them by phone.
If taxis are more your style, check out Train Taxi for options available in the vicinity. While there may not be a taxi rank directly at the station, local services are readily accessible, ensuring you can reach your final destination smoothly.
